Sealing Entry Points
Spiders can enter your home through even the smallest cracks and openings. We can advise on or assist with sealing potential entry points, such as gaps around windows and doors, cracks in the foundation, and openings around utility lines. This simple step can significantly reduce the number of spiders that make their way inside.
Reducing Spider Attractants
Spiders are often attracted to homes by the presence of other insects, which are their food source. We can provide advice on reducing other insect populations around your home, such as eliminating standing water, keeping outdoor lights off at night or using yellow bulbs which attract fewer insects, and properly storing trash. Managing the food source for spiders is a proactive way to deter them.

Wolf Spiders
Wolf spiders are larger, hairy spiders that actively hunt for prey rather than spinning webs. They can be startling to encounter due to their size and speed. While their bites can be painful, they are generally not dangerous to humans. Black Widow Spiders
Black Widow spiders are one of the venomous spider species found in California. They are known for the red hourglass shape on their abdomen and their potent venom. A Black Widow bite requires immediate medical attention. We strongly advise against attempting to remove Black Widow spiders yourself. Brown Recluse Spiders (Less Common but Possible)
While less common in California compared to other parts of the country, Brown Recluse spiders can occasionally be found. They are known for the violin-shaped marking on their back and their venomous bite, which can cause significant tissue damage. Like Black Widows, Brown Recluse spider bites require immediate medical attention. If you suspect you've seen a Brown Recluse spider, contact us immediately. Seasonal Preventative Treatments
Spider activity can vary with the seasons. Implementing seasonal preventative treatments can be highly effective in keeping spiders out of your home. For example, treating in the late summer and fall before spiders seek shelter from cooler temperatures can significantly reduce the number of spiders that enter your home during the winter. Spring treatments can also help control spider populations as they become more active. Timing treatments with the natural behavior of spiders ensures maximum effectiveness in preventing infestations year-round.
